The Good Society Seminar is one of the few moments in the year where ALI SA Fellows step back from the pressure of daily leadership and return to the seminar table.
From 15–17 May 2026, Fellows will gather at De Hoek Country Hotel in Magaliesburg for a weekend of thoughtful dialogue, reflection and connection across the fellowship.
It is also an opportunity to reconnect with classmates, reflect on how your journeys have unfolded and come together again as a cohort.
The Good Society Seminar is a space for open and honest conversation, intellectual challenge and shared reflection on the values that shape our leadership and our society.
